In this video I take items that I already had in my stash to use to make 50 cards. You will see many different style of cards, some that I had in my card case for years and I gave them an upgrade. I used different techniques from tearing paper and adding embellishments you have on hand to using my gelatos to create a beautiful look to your Valentine's cards. I also used sprays from Tim Holtz, Color Bloom and Heidi Swap to create a look that is very stunning.

The instructions for this Valentine's Day Treat Box I received many years ago (7-9 years) from a Stamp'in Up gathering I went too. It's a little box that is just so cute to place little chocolate's inside for your sweeties'. :D  And with Valentine's Day approaching why not make a couple for your kids, grandkids, family members, office co-workers, or friends.

The box is really simple and only takes a few supplies, unless your like me and love embellishments.

Here is what you need:

  • Cardstock - 2 sheets of any color you want
  • Stamp - Crafty Sentiments Stamps
Optional Accessories:

  • Embossing folder - you choice
  • Punches - your choice
  • and any other little accessories/embellishments you want to add
